Keynote.

An ultra stable, confidence inspiring foil board designed to make standing, balancing, and learning feel natural from the very first session.

Intro.

The Drifter Spark is designed as the ideal first step into foiling. The focus is static stability, easy balance, and confidence underfoot, so new or heavier riders can stand comfortably and learn board and wing control without worrying about takeoff speed. With generous width and carefully distributed volume, the Spark makes it possible to stand relaxed, even with no wind or forward motion. That stability makes it especially effective for light wind, early tow foiling progression, beginner Foil Assist or eFoil sessions, and SUP foil surf entry, where predictability and balance unlock confidence.

Feeling.

The Drifter Spark feels extremely stable and planted underfoot, with a wide and supportive standing area that allows riders to relax and focus on fewer variables. The board remains calm and predictable in light wind, chop, and low speed situations, making it easier to progress through early sessions without falling frequently and feeling unsteady.

Speed.

Speed is intentionally secondary to stability and control on the Drifter Spark. The shape supports smooth, controlled acceleration and gentle lift off and rebounds at low speeds, helping riders build confidence without sudden reactions. This predictable behavior allows beginners to focus on wing handling without worrying about stability.

Description.

The Drifter Spark was born to remove barriers of entry into foiling. Learning to foil takes time, balance, and repetition, and this board is designed to support that process at every step. Its wide outline and forgiving shape allow riders to stand comfortably, practice wing handling, and develop muscle memory during first flights and at any wind speeds.

For heavy riders, beginners, schools, rental centers, and instructors, durability and consistency are just as important as stability. The Spark is built to handle heavy repeated use and a wide range of riders while remaining predictable and confidence inspiring. The Spark provides a stress-free path into winging, beginner tow foiling, foil assist, or eFoiling without feeling tippy, intimidating, or unstable.

Shape.

Wide and stable outline with generous volume distribution focused on static balance and low speed control. The shape prioritizes ease of standing, predictability, and directional stability.

Highlights.

Bottom.

Subtle double concave displacement stable bottom with flatter contours designed to maximize balance at low speeds and provide smooth, forgiving lift off and rebounds.

Rocker.

Moderate entry and forgiving rocker profile tuned for easy lift off and minimal resistance at slow speeds, helping beginners’ transition smoothly toward flight without needing to adjust footing.

Rails.

Soft rails designed to reduce catches and improve stability during movement, taxiing, and low speed transitions.

Agility.

Low agility by design. The Drifter Spark favors calm, predictable behavior over responsiveness, allowing riders to learn and progress.

Size Guide.

130 Liters 6’4″ x 29.5″

Confidence focused size that makes standing, balancing, and handling the wing feel natural from the first session. Well suited for beginner wing foilers, tow foilers, and Foil Assist riders looking for a stable platform to learn foil control. A strong option for lighter to mid weight riders and instructional settings.

• Foil Assist for Beginners — 30 to 80 kg / 70 to 180 lbs
• Wingfoil for Beginner wingers — 30 to 75 kg / 70 to 170 lbs
• Tow foil for Beginners — 30 to 80 kg / 70 to 180 lbs
• Surf SUP Foil for Beginner riders — 30 to 70 kg / 70 to 155 lbs
• Ideal for first sessions, light wind learning, and rental or school environments

150 Liters 6’8″ x 30.5″

High stability option designed for heavier riders or anyone prioritizing ease and balance while learning. The added volume allows riders to stand relaxed, manage the wing comfortably, and take off to foil with less effort. Excellent for light wind learning, foil assist progression, and SUP foil surf entry.

• Foil Assist for Beginners — 40 to 95 kg / 90 to 210 lbs
• Wingfoil for Beginner wingers — 40 to 90 kg / 90 to 200 lbs
• Tow foil for Beginners — 40 to 95 kg / 90 to 210 lbs
• Surf SUP Foil for Beginner to Intermediate riders — 40 to 85 kg / 90 to 190 lbs
• Excellent option for families or heavier riders progressing into foiling with confidence

170 Liters 7’10” x 32.5″

Maximum stability platform for first time riders, instruction, and rental environments. The large standing area and generous volume make it easy to stay balanced while learning wing handling, beginner tow starts, or foil assist basics. Especially well-suited for heavier riders, family lessons, and high use teaching scenarios.

• Foil Assist for Beginners — 60 to 120 kg / 135 to 265 lbs
• Wingfoil for Beginner wingers — 60 to 120 kg / 135 to 265 lbs
• Tow foil for Beginners — 60 to 120 kg / 135 to 265 lbs
• Surf SUP Foil for Beginner to Intermediate riders — 60 to 105 kg / 135 to 235 lbs
• Ideal for families, schools, rentals, and riders prioritizing ease of use and confidence
